Transaction 594f23eea587310e16cfd51ba22c97916c86d725609e405b272fc7f5e0a6921f

20 Input
2 Outputs
  • 594f23eea587310e16cfd51ba22c97916c86d725609e405b272fc7f5e0a6921f:0
  • value  80018
    address  1FnyMQZqNPDruztZNcZnVSxq4TNAkueEMj
  • 594f23eea587310e16cfd51ba22c97916c86d725609e405b272fc7f5e0a6921f:1
  • value  34000000
    address  3E9xXWuVKoRK9DfDmzPwafCXmZmZGv9bMt